gpt4 book ai didi

html - 对于以下下拉列表, 'required' 属性不起作用

转载 作者:太空宇宙 更新时间:2023-11-04 14:03:00 25 4
gpt4 key购买 nike

如果用户从选项中选择“- - select - -”,则应将其视为空白字段。它应该触发“必填”属性,以便浏览器在提交表单时显示警告消息:“请填写此字段”。

我很努力,但没有找到解决方案。

HTML:

<form>
<select id="post" name="post" required="required" title="post you are applying for" class="formfield3" />

<option value="0"> - - select - -</option>
<option value="1">Mobile App Developer</option>
<option value="2">DataBase Administrator</option>
<option value="3">Search Engine Optimizer</option>
<option value="4">Product Manager</option>
<option value="5">HR Manager</option>

</select>

<input type=submit>
</form>

我使用的是最新版本的 chrome,'required' 正在为文本字段等其他标签工作。

最佳答案

要使浏览器将其视为空白字段,请将其设为空白 - 将 0 更改为空字符串:

<select id="post" name="post" required="required" title="post you are applying for" class="formfield3" />

<option value=""> - - select - -</option>
<option value="1">Mobile App Developer</option>
<option value="2">DataBase Administrator</option>
<option value="3">Search Engine Optimizer</option>
<option value="4">Product Manager</option>
<option value="5">HR Manager</option>

</select>

关于html - 对于以下下拉列表, 'required' 属性不起作用,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/22457829/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com